Scientists in India found a very old bamboo stem that is 37,000 years old.

This bamboo is special because it has marks from thorns, which are like little spikes that protect the plant.

The bamboo was found in a river in Manipur, a place in northeastern India.

This discovery is important because it shows that bamboo with thorns existed in Asia a long time ago, during the Ice Age.

Most other bamboos died in colder places, but this one survived in the warm and humid climate of Northeast India.

The scientists studied the bamboo and compared it to modern bamboos to learn more about how it lived and protected itself.

This finding helps us understand the history of plants and how they adapted to different climates.

Quotes

Government release

Official statement from the government

“This is the first fossil evidence that thorniness in bamboo—a defence against herbivores—was already present in Asia during the Ice Age. Its preservation is particularly significant because it comes from a period of colder and drier global climates, when bamboo was wiped out in many other regions, including Europe. The fossil shows that while harsh Ice Age conditions restricted bamboo's global distribution, Northeast India provided a safe refuge where the plant could continue to thrive.”
